The Girl in the Spider's Web (2018) is a techno-thriller that continues the legacy of Stieg Larsson's Millennium universe, though it adapts a novel written by David Lagercrantz rather than Larsson himself. This installment introduces a new cinematic take on Lisbeth Salander, the fiercely independent hacker with a traumatic past, and places her at the center of a high-stakes conspiracy that blends cybercrime, espionage, and personal vendetta. The film both honors and departs from the tone of earlier adaptations, offering sleek visuals, rapid pacing, and modernized stakes rooted in the vulnerabilities of the digital age. Plot and Themes The narrative follows Lisbeth Salander, a brilliant but socially isolated hacker, who becomes entangled in a plot involving stolen artificial intelligence research, government corruption, and covert operations. When Lisbeth crosses paths with Mikael Blomkvist, an investigative journalist with a persistent moral compass, the two form an uneasy alliance to uncover the truth. Their investigation leads them into a tangled web of criminal hackers, intelligence operatives, and a powerful figure from Lisbeth’s past whose motives are personal as well as geopolitical.

Characters and Performances Claire Foy steps into the role of Lisbeth Salander, taking over from previous film portrayals. Foy brings a quieter, colder intensity to Lisbeth, balancing fragility with moments of focused, almost clinical violence. Her portrayal emphasizes Lisbeth’s intelligence and guarded vulnerability rather than overt theatricality.
Sverrir Gudnason plays Mikael Blomkvist, offering a steadier, more grounded counterpart to Lisbeth’s volatility. Their chemistry is cautious but productive: Blomkvist’s investigative persistence complements Lisbeth’s technical brilliance, and their partnership is the emotional core of the film.
Other notable characters include antagonists and shadowy figures from intelligence communities, criminal enterprises, and Lisbeth’s personal history. The supporting cast supplies the necessary menace and moral ambiguity, though some critics note that several characters remain thinly sketched given the film’s brisk pace.

The screenplay condenses complex plotting into a taut 115–120 minute runtime, prioritizing momentum over exhaustive exposition. This results in a film that moves quickly through plot points; viewers who enjoy fast-paced thrillers will appreciate the drive, while those seeking deep character explorations may find elements underdeveloped.

Context within the Millennium Franchise This film represents a continuation and reimagining rather than a direct sequel to earlier screen adaptations. It updates the Millennium universe for contemporary concerns—AI, hacking, and data control—while attempting to maintain the franchise’s core focus on Lisbeth’s fight against personal and systemic injustices. As such, it functions both as a standalone thriller and a piece of a larger narrative tapestry for those familiar with the novels and prior films.
